mysql文件怎么附加
时间 : 2023-08-06 07:23:02声明: : 文章内容来自网络,不保证准确性,请自行甄别信息有效性

在使用 MySQL 数据库时,可以通过附加数据库文件的方式来添加数据库到 MySQL 服务器中。附加数据库文件可以是 MysQL 格式的备份文件(.sql),也可以是以特定格式存储的数据库文件(.frm、.ibd)。

以下是附加 MySQL 数据库文件的步骤:

1. 打开命令行终端或者图形界面工具(如 phpMyAdmin)以连接到 MySQL 服务器。

2. 输入 MySQL 用户名和密码进行登录。

3. 创建一个新的数据库(可选步骤):

```

CREATE DATABASE database_name;

```

4. 使用以下命令附加数据库文件:

```

USE database_name;

SOURCE /path/to/your/file.sql;

```

上述命令中,`database_name` 是你想要将数据库文件附加到的数据库名称,`/path/to/your/file.sql` 是数据库文件的完整路径。

如果数据库文件是以 `.sql` 格式保存的备份文件,可以使用 `SOURCE` 命令直接导入文件内容到指定数据库。

如果数据库文件是以特定格式(如 `.frm` 和 `.ibd`)保存的数据文件,则需要将文件复制到 MySQL 数据库的数据目录中,然后通过执行以下命令附加数据库:

```

USE database_name;

ALTER TABLE table_name DISCARD TABLESPACE;

ALTER TABLE table_name IMPORT TABLESPACE;

```

上述命令中,`database_name` 是要附加数据库的名称,`table_name` 是具体要附加的数据表的名称。

5. 等待数据导入完成,附加数据库操作就完成了。

需要注意的是,在附加数据库文件之前,确保 MySQL 服务器已经创建和配置正确,并且具有足够的权限来执行附加操作。此外,附加数据库可能需要一定的时间,取决于数据库文件的大小和服务器性能。

附加数据库文件是将现有数据添加到 MySQL 数据库中的一种方法。这对于备份恢复、数据库迁移和数据共享非常有用。